Deep breaths. I know this is concerning and the people of Texas need to vote the controlling crazy politicians out who are scaring people with ongoing threats about pregnancy.

Your Medicaid won’t know the outcome of your pregnancy. It’s legal to travel out side your state to have an abortion and it’s legal to have a miscarriage.

Not everyone who has an early miscarriage seeks medical attention. It can seem like a heavy period even at 11 weeks for some people. There is no penalty for not seeking treatment during a miscarriage and seeking treatment won’t stop a miscarriage from happening, so there is no threat to “ neglecting the fetus”

Deep breaths. You are okay
